Top 7 Best Value Colleges for General Industrial Engineering in New York (With Aid)

1

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Columbia University in the City of New York. It ranked #1 on our 2023 Best Value General IE Schools in New York For Those Getting Aid list. This large school is located in New York, New York, and it awarded 123 ’s general IE degrees in 2020-2021.

Columbia also took the #1 spot in our “Best General Industrial Engineering Schools in New York” ranking. The yearly cost to attend Columbia University in the City of New York is $22,823 for new york general ie students with aid.

The undergraduate student-to-faculty ratio of 6 to 1 is a sign that students will have more opportunities to engage with their professors one-on-one. The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 1.7%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%.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 95%.

2
University at Buffalo crest
University at Buffalo
Buffalo, New York

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University at Buffalo. The school came in at #2 for the Best Value General IE Schools in New York For Those Getting Aid. Buffalo, New York is the setting for this large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out ’s general IE degrees to 217 students in 2020-2021.

University at Buffalo not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#3 on our “Best General Industrial Engineering Schools in New York” list. It costs about $19,262 for new york general ie students with aid per year to attend University at Buffalo.

With a freshman retention rate of 87%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its undergraduate students. The low undergrad student loan default rate of 2.8%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%.

3
Binghamton University crest
Binghamton University
Vestal, New York

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Binghamton University. The school came in at #3 for the Best Value General IE Schools in New York For Those Getting Aid. Binghamton University is a fairly large school located in Vestal, New York that handed out 162 ’s general IE degrees in 2020-2021.

As a testament to the quality of education offered at Binghamton University, the school also landed the #4 spot in our “Best General Industrial Engineering Schools in New York” ranking. It costs about $20,703 for new york general ie students with aid per year to attend Binghamton University.

The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 92%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year. The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 1.9%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.
